there is no real server side to this, but you do need to serve the code up from either localhost or a site with SSL enabled.
if on Mac or Linux, you can start a simple webserver by running: python -m SimpleHTTPServer 8080
Your laptop MUST have BLE support for this to work.
Copy and paste the contents of the microbit.ts file into the https://pxt.microbit.org/ editor to get a .hex